Wild Weather Continues In Rocky Mountains, Eastern Plains

DENVER (AP) – A large storm that brought a series of tornadoes to eastern Colorado has dumped up to a foot of snow in Wyoming and is expected to continue to bring hail and rain to the Rocky Mountains and Eastern Plains through Monday.
National Weather Service forecaster Timothy Trudel said Sunday a foot of snow has already fallen on mountain ranges about 40 miles west of Laramie.
